Category overview
Precision where medical performance depends on consistency
Medical device components often combine complex geometry, tight interfaces, demanding surface requirements, and strict material controls. AXALLOY evaluates the part design, alloy behavior, tolerance scheme, inspection strategy, and production volume before defining a reliable manufacturing route.
Our Shenzhen-based team works with OEMs, engineering firms, contract manufacturers, and supplier-quality teams on surgical components, diagnostic equipment, titanium parts, prototypes, and other precision-machined medical applications.
Difficult alloys
Inconel, titanium, stainless steels, cobalt alloys, and selected specialty metals.
Complex machining
Multi-axis milling, turning, mill-turn, Swiss CNC, EDM, and precision grinding.
Quality evidence
Dimensional inspection, first article reports, material traceability, and special-process records.
Engineering support
Drawing review, DFM feedback, tolerance analysis, fixture planning, and process development.
